Output 516f08c898117a655d6438eb9a51e12278fe8deb958a2f5d895d035884756152:1

value
20528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a76905af420277695ee093aeaee2b9378add8aee OP_EQUAL
address
A7hTKVjQqjoGTbdV87dXJs6oBmFQs8d6f9
transaction
516f08c898117a655d6438eb9a51e12278fe8deb958a2f5d895d035884756152